The place of Jalapita is inside the municipality of Centla (in the State of Tabasco). There are 1,154 inhabitants. In the list of the most populated towns of the whole municipality, it is the number #16 of the ranking. Jalapita is at 1 meters of altitude.

Data: In Jalapita, 26% of individuals have completed secondary education and 16% of households have a personal computer, laptop or tablet. More interesting data at the bottom of this page.

Do you want to locate the town of Jalapita? You can find it at 39.0 kilometers, in direction West, from the town of Frontera, which has the largest population within the municipality.
